MLIA-650 Implement new CLI changes
Breaking change in the CLI and API: Sub-commands "optimization", "operators", and "performance" were replaced by "check", which incorporates compatibility and performance checks, and "optimize" which is used for optimization. "get_advice" API was adapted to these CLI changes. API changes: * Remove previous advice category "all" that would perform all three operations (when possible). Replace them with the ability to pass a set of the advice categories. * Update api.get_advice method docstring to reflect new changes. * Set default advice category to COMPATIBILITY * Update core.common.AdviceCategory by changing the "OPERATORS" advice category to "COMPATIBILITY" and removing "ALL" enum type. Update all subsequent methods that previously used "OPERATORS" to use "COMPATIBILITY". * Update core.context.ExecutionContext to have "COMPATIBILITY" as default advice_category instead of "ALL". * Remove api.generate_supported_operators_report and all related functions from cli.commands, cli.helpers, cli.main, cli.options, core.helpers * Update tests to reflect new API changes. CLI changes: * Update README.md to contain information on the new CLI * Remove the ability to generate supported operators support from MLIA CLI * Replace `mlia ops` and `mlia perf` with the new `mlia check` command that can be used to perform both operations. * Replace `mlia opt` with the new `mlia optimize` command. * Replace `--evaluate-on` flag with `--backend` flag * Replace `--verbose` flag with `--debug` flag (no behaviour change). * Remove the ability for the user to select MLIA working directory. Create and use a temporary directory in /temp instead. * Change behaviour of `--output` flag to not format the content automatically based on file extension anymore. Instead it will simply redirect to a file. * Add the `--json` flag to specfy that the format of the output should be json. * Add command validators that are used to validate inter-dependent flags (e.g. backend validation based on target_profile). * Add support for selecting built-in backends for both `check` and `optimize` commands. * Add new unit tests and update old ones to test the new CLI changes. * Update RELEASES.md * Update copyright notice Change-Id: Ia6340797c7bee3acbbd26601950e5a16ad5602db
